플랫폼 종속 코드 분리 대장 문서.양식
첨부된 "양식 파일" 다운로드 링크는 아래로 내리시면 연관(관련)된 서식 목록 아래 쪽에 있습니다.
소프트웨어 개발 과정에서 발생하는 플랫폼별 종속성을 효과적으로 관리하고 분리하기 위한 중요한 기술 문서로 코드의 이식성과 유지보수성을 높이는 서식으로 플랫폼, 코드상태, 담당자, 코드위치, 기능설명, 검증일으로 구성 되어 있습니다.
코드분리 주요항목
코드분리 주요항목
- 플랫폼 종속성: 다양한 실행 환경에서 호환될 수 있는 공통 코드 구조를 설계하고 표준화하는 방안을 제시합니다.
- 분리 전략: 모듈화된 소프트웨어 아키텍처를 통해 플랫폼별 의존성을 최소화하고 재사용 가능한 코드 구조를 확립합니다.
- 기능 추상화: 특정 플랫폼에 종속되지 않는 일반화된 인터페이스와 추상 클래스를 활용하여 코드의 유연성을 확보합니다.
- 환경 분기 처리: 서로 다른 플랫폼의 특성을 고려한 조건부 컴파일과 런타임 환경 분기 메커니즘을 구현합니다.
- 의존성 관리: 외부 라이브러리와 프레임워크의 플랫폼별 특성을 체계적으로 분석하고 대응 방안을 마련합니다.
- 테스트 전략: 다중 플랫폼 환경에서의 코드 호환성을 검증할 수 있는 포괄적인 테스트 케이스를 개발합니다.
첨부파일
